How Unity Simplifies Cross-Platform Game Creation

One of the biggest advantages of Unity is how easily it supports multiple platforms.

Developers can create a game once and deploy it across Android, iOS, PC, and more without rebuilding everything from scratch. This saves time, reduces costs, and speeds up the entire development cycle.

For businesses, this means reaching a wider audience without doubling the effort. And for players, it means a consistent experience no matter where they play.

Why Developers Prefer Unity for 2D and 3D Games

Unity is not limited to one style of game. 

It works just as well for simple 2D games as it does for detailed 3D environments. Developers can switch between styles, experiment with ideas, and build different types of experiences using the same engine.

This flexibility allows teams to focus more on creativity instead of worrying about technical limitations. Whether it’s a casual mobile game or a complex 3D world, Unity provides the tools to bring it to life.
